Today&#8217;s dental mixing guns offer unprecedented precision, consistency, and time savings that directly translate to better patient outcomes and increased practice profitability.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Modern impression material dispensers utilize sophisticated mechanical ratios to ensure perfect mixing every time. Unlike traditional hand mixing methods that often result in air bubbles, inconsistent ratios, or material waste, these devices deliver homogeneous mixtures with optimal working properties.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_5\">Key Components and Mechanisms<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The auto-mixing impression gun consists of several critical components working in harmony: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Dual-barrel cartridge system<\/strong>\u00a0: Accommodates base and catalyst materials<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Plunger mechanism<\/strong>\u00a0: Provides controlled, consistent pressure<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Mixing tips<\/strong>\u00a0: Ensure thorough blending through static mixing elements<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Trigger mechanism<\/strong>\u00a0: Offers precise flow control<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Release lever<\/strong>\u00a0: Prevents material waste between applications<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Understanding these components helps practitioners troubleshoot issues and maintain optimal performance throughout the device&#8217;s lifespan.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-stackable-image aligncenter stk-block-image stk-block stk-61f65bf\" data-block-id=\"61f65bf\"><figure><span class=\"stk-img-wrapper \/><\/span><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_10\">Types of Impression Dispensing Guns and Their Applications<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_11\">Manual vs. Electric Dispensing Systems<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The dental dispensing system market offers two primary categories, each with distinct advantages: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Manual Dispensing Guns: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Cost-effective initial investment<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>No power requirements<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Lightweight and portable<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Ideal for low-volume practices<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Requires more physical effort<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Electric Dispensing Guns: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Consistent flow rate<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Reduced hand fatigue<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Higher precision control<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Better for high-volume practices<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Higher initial investment<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_17\">Specialized Systems for Different Materials<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Different impression materials require specific mixing tip systems and dispensing ratios: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Polyvinyl Siloxane (PVS) Systems<\/strong>\u00a0: Require 1:1 or 10:1 mixing ratios<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Polyether Systems<\/strong>\u00a0: Typically use 1:1 ratios with specialized tips<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Alginate Substitute Systems<\/strong>\u00a0: Need specific cartridge configurations<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Bite Registration Materials<\/strong>\u00a0: Utilize smaller, more precise tips<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-stackable-image aligncenter \/><\/span><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_35\">Best Practices for Optimal Performance<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_36\">Proper Loading and Preparation Techniques<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Maximizing your impression gun maintenance starts with proper loading procedures: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Inspect cartridge integrity<\/strong>\u00a0before loading<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Remove air bubbles<\/strong>\u00a0by expressing small amount of material<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Attach mixing tip<\/strong>\u00a0firmly with quarter-turn lock<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Prime the system<\/strong>\u00a0with 1-2 trigger pulls<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Check flow consistency<\/strong>\u00a0before patient application<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_39\">Clinical Application Guidelines<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Achieving consistent results requires attention to technique: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Temperature Considerations: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Store materials at room temperature (68-72\u00b0F)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Allow refrigerated materials to equilibrate<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Consider seasonal temperature variations<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Application Speed: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Maintain steady, consistent pressure<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Avoid stopping mid-impression<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Complete full-arch impressions within working time<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"_45\">Troubleshooting Common Issues<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Even the best dental mixing gun can encounter problems.
